#f5484d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f5484d is composed of 96.1% red, 28.2%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.6% magenta, 68.6%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 358.3 degrees, a saturation of 89.6% and a lightness of 62.2%. #f5484d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ff909a with #eb0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3366.

#f5484d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f5484d has RGB values of R:245, G:72,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.71, Y:0.69,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16074829.
